Fantastic Chicken Curry Recipe #42882

This curry is easy with the addition of ready-made curry powder instead of making your own. The mango chutney gives a nice touch. Goes nice with rice, and warm Indian breads too!
by Sue L

40 min | 10 min prep

SERVES 4

  1. Mix flour, salt and pepper together on a shallow plate; dredge chicken in flour and shake off excess.
  2. Heat oil in a large skillet and add chicken, browning on both sides (add more oil if necessary); remove to a plate.
  3. Add the onion, bell pepper, and garlic to the pan and cook until onion is tender, about 5 minutes.
  4. Add curry powder, coating onions, etc; then add potatoes, broth, chutney, to the skillet.
  5. Bring it all to a boil, add the chicken, then reduce heat, cover, and simmer cooking until chicken is cooked through and potatoes are tender, about 20-22 minutes.
  6. Garnish with cilantro, and serve with rice, if desired.
